What Does Pergola Installation Cost in Sheridan, IN?

Pergola projects generally start around $5,000 and can reach $30,000 or more depending on the size, materials, and features involved.

Those numbers come from past project estimates, and your project will land somewhere specific based on the details unique to your yard and your goals.

The easiest way to get an accurate number is to reach out with your specifics so we can put something real together for you.

Here are five factors that typically move the cost:

1.Size of the Structure

A compact 10×12 pergola costs considerably less than a sprawling structure that runs along the full back of the house. Every additional square foot adds material and labor costs, so size tends to be the single biggest cost driver.

2. Material Choice

Wood, aluminum, vinyl, fiberglass, and composite pergolas each have a different price point and maintenance profile, with their own lifespans. The right material depends on how much upkeep you want to take on over the years and what kind of look you’re going for.

3. Added Features

Built-in lighting, retractable roofs, motorized systems, privacy screens, and built-in seating all add to the final cost. They also add a lot of everyday value, so it’s worth having that conversation early in the design process.

4. Site Conditions

Flat, straightforward sites are the simplest to build on. Yards with slopes, drainage issues, or soil conditions that need extra prep work affect the foundation and installation process.

5. Custom Finishes and Detailing

Decorative post details, specialty staining, and custom finishes raise the number, but they also push the end result well beyond what you’d get from a prefabricated kit. For some homeowners, the extra investment is usually worth it.

Common Questions About Pergola Installation in Sheridan, IN

In most cases, yes. Sheridan follows Hamilton County building codes, and pergolas attached to a home or exceeding a certain size typically require a permit. We handle the permitting process as part of our service, so that piece is taken care of without you having to figure it out.
The actual installation usually takes 1 to 3 days. The full timeline from design to completion depends on material lead times and permitting, both of which vary by project. We walk you through a realistic schedule during the initial consultation so there are no vague estimates.
Indiana weather puts outdoor structures through a real test. Composite and aluminum options tend to require the least maintenance over time. Wood is beautiful and can last for decades with proper care. We’ll walk you through the trade-offs so you can choose what makes sense for the level of upkeep you actually want to take on.
